About Comanche, OK
Comanche is a small town located in Oklahoma with a population of 1,625 residents according to the latest US Census Bureau American Community Survey data. The median household income is $39,667 per year, which is 47% below the national median of $75,149. The median age of 45.5 years is notably older the US median age of 38.9 years, suggesting a more established community with a higher proportion of long-term residents.
Housing Market Overview
The housing market in Comanche features a median home value of $71,200, which is 71% below the national median of $244,900. This makes Comanche one of the more affordable markets in the country, potentially attractive for first-time homebuyers. Median monthly rent is $713, 39% below the national average of $1,163/month. Of the 848 total housing units, 59% are owner-occupied (376 units) and 41% are renter-occupied (266 units). The balanced mix of owners and renters indicates a diverse housing market.
Economy & Employment
The local economy in Comanche shows an unemployment rate of 5.6%, which is significantly above the national rate of 3.7%, suggesting economic challenges in the area. The poverty rate stands at 27.2%, above the national average of 12.4%. Workers in Comanche have an average one-way commute time of 22.9 minutes.
